Pfizer COVID vaccine: UK regulators say people with history of serious allergic reactions shouldn’t get jab – 7NEWS.com.au
Two people have had an adverse reaction to the new Pfizer shot on the first day of the UK’s mass vaccination program.

UK regulators say people who have a significant history of allergic reactions shouldnt receive the new Pfizer-BioNTech coronavirus vaccine while they investigate two adverse reactions that occurred on the first day of the countrys mass vaccination program.
Professor Stephen Powis, national medical director for the National Health Service in England, said health authorities were acting on a recommendation from the Medical and Healthcare Products Regulatory Agency, the nations medicines regulator.
